How SEO Strengthens Brand Visibility

SEO turns an unseen site into a visible brand asset. Appearing in local searches attracts customers. SEO and digital services track rankings, traffic, and leads monthly to gauge progress. Keyword research guides content, on-page optimization, and outreach.

Local SEO starts with consistent business listings and a verified Google Business Profile. NAP consistency across platforms increases search trust. Encourage reviews and respond quickly to enhance reputation signals, impacting local pack placement.

Use geo-targeted pages and local posts to capture nearby demand. Local pages need clear contact info, service coverage, and local intent. Marketing1on1 and similar partners often recommend mapping content to buyer needs to increase conversions from local traffic.

Technical and on-page SEO essentials keep sites crawlable and user-friendly. Quick load times with mobile-first design lower bounce and lift rankings. Verify HTTPS, resolve redirect chains, and eliminate duplicates to avoid indexing issues.

Site structure matters. Apply clear hierarchy, descriptive titles, headings, and intent-led meta descriptions. Body copy must be natural, driven by keyword research, and focused on user value. Tools like Google Search Console and Google Keyword Planner support tracking and refinement.

Content and link building raise authority and create referral traffic. Publish guides, data-led infographics, and guest posts to earn backlinks. Partnering with chambers and community blogs builds relevant links and visibility.

Track KPIs such as top rankings, local pack impressions, organic traffic, and leads. Monthly reporting should link metrics to conversion improvements. Combining technical, on-page, and outreach work delivers the biggest gains.

Platform Choice and Content Mix

Find where customers spend time and tailor strategy. If visual, use high-quality images and shoppable posts. Services should share case studies and LinkedIn content. Often, two strong platforms beat six weak ones.

Organic vs. paid social advertising

Organic social nurtures community and brand character. Paid social increases reach and targets precise audiences. Even with limited budgets, targeted campaigns can drive conversions by focusing on intent and clear calls to action. Marketing1on1-type agencies mix organic reach with paid acceleration.

Social Reputation & Reviews

Keep an eye on comments, messages, and mentions. Courteous, timely replies reduce friction and boost WOM. Invite reviews and share customer content with permission. Cross-platform review tracking surfaces trends and improvement areas.

Content Types That Work for SMBs

Begin with a content audit to identify top performers. Mix long- and short-form assets aligned to search intent and social behavior. Evergreen content provides consistent traffic. How-to guides address common queries. Case studies show real results and increase conversion rates.

Leverage testimonials as text and video. Testimonials build social proof locally. Repurpose a single case study into various formats like blog posts, emails, short videos, and social media cards to maximize resource efficiency.

Best Practices for Video Marketing

Align video to awareness, lead-gen, or sales goals. Ensure clear value within the first 10 seconds. Use captions to support silent viewing. Optimize titles and descriptions for search to enhance organic reach.

Agencies providing digital marketing services can assist with scriptwriting, shooting, and editing. Let experts produce so owners can focus on the core. Monitor views, watch time, comments, and click-through rates to gauge impact.

Repurpose Content for Broader Impact

Repurpose to multiply reach with minimal effort. Turn a blog into short videos and an email series. Cut long videos into clips for Reels, Shorts, and Facebook. Share quotes from case studies to push traffic.

Search and display advertising

Search ads capture intent at the moment of Google search. Teams select keywords, create copy, and set bids. Display relies on visuals to build recognition.

Effective setups segment branded/high-ROI terms from broad terms. This approach keeps cost per acquisition low while maintaining reach for awareness goals.

Social media ad targeting and budgeting

Social ads target by demographics/interests/behaviors. Facebook and Instagram ads are great for visual offers. LinkedIn suits B2B. Short videos on TikTok reach younger segments.

Start with a modest daily budget and scale winners. Set device and geographic limits to avoid waste. Agencies test to find cost-efficient audiences.

Choosing goals and measuring ad performance

Define clear goals—awareness, leads, sales. Measure conversions and CPA to evaluate success. Apply UTM tagging and analytics to attribute traffic.

Run A/B tests on headlines, creatives, and landing pages. Review metrics like click-through rate, conversion rate, and return on ad spend. Marketing1on1 suggests frequent optimizations with transparent reporting.

Email Marketing & CRM-Driven Retention

Email provides a direct line for post-purchase engagement. CRM-linked email makes messages timely and personalized. Small businesses can increase repeat purchases with simple journeys. Journeys include welcomes, cart recovery, and win-backs.

Start collecting emails via checkout, site forms, and POS guest books. Store addresses in your CMS, CRM, or an automation tool like HubSpot. Offer incentives (discounts/guides) to grow lists without being intrusive.

Building and Storing Your Email List

Keep lists clean—confirm subs and remove hard bounces. Use CRM to unify sales/support data. This ensures records include purchase history and preferences. Such a view enhances segmentation and reporting for retention marketing.

Automating with Segmentation

Use demographic, interest, and behavioral segments for relevance. Simple personalization can lift engagement.

Automation scales welcomes, cart recovery, and win-backs without more staff. Agencies providing digital marketing services often set up these automations. They test timing to improve ROI.

Email Content & Measurement

Create mobile-first emails with clear calls to action. Test subject lines and sending times to enhance open rates and CTR. Measure opens/CTR/conversions to judge performance.

Design for Conversions

High-converting pages use clear CTAs, visual hierarchy, and mobile-first layouts. CRO benefits from simplified forms, bold buttons, and persona-focused content. It’s essential to avoid heavy carousels and trim form fields to shorten decision time and boost clicks.

Technical Reliability & Hosting

Speedy hosting, SSL, backups, and malware checks are vital. DDoS monitoring plus up-to-date PHP/plugins prevents problems. Stable tech improves UX/SEO, strengthening campaigns.

eCommerce & Checkout Optimization

Simplified checkout lowers cart abandonment. Baymard finds optimized checkout can raise conversions up to 35%. Verified payments, guest checkout, and clear progress cues encourage completion.
